What Is Manta Village?

Manta Village is located near Keauhou Bay, south of Kailua-Kona. It’s one of the original manta viewing sites and is known for being more sheltered and closer to shore.

Why It’s Known:

  • Shorter boat rides from Keauhou
  • Long-standing manta observation site
  • Commonly used by operators departing south Kona

Because of its proximity to shore, it’s often associated with quicker trips and more time-efficient tours.

What Is Manta Heaven?

Manta Heaven, located near Garden Eel Cove (closer to the Kona airport area), is another major manta hotspot known for strong nightly activity and open-ocean conditions.

Why It’s Popular:

  • Often stronger manta gatherings on favorable nights
  • More open ocean environment
  • Frequently used by operators departing north Kona

This site is widely recognized for delivering some of the most active manta encounters in the region.

Which Site Has Better Manta Sightings?

Both Manta Village and Manta Heaven can deliver incredible sightings, and there is no guaranteed “better” location every night.

However, many experienced operators choose based on:

  • Current plankton conditions
  • Water clarity
  • Wind and swell direction
  • Manta feeding activity that night

That flexibility is what often determines the quality of your experience—not just the site name.
